About Bodega Bay

Bodega Bay enchants visitors with pristine beaches, dramatic coastal cliffs, and working fishing village charm. The iconic Bodega Head State Park offers hiking, whale-watching, and tide pooling. Local restaurants, art galleries, and shops line the harbor. Rich maritime history, farm-to-table dining, and wine country proximity enhance lifestyle appeal. Strong community events, farmer's markets, and outdoor recreation attract diverse demographics. Excellent K-12 schools and relatively low crime rates support family living alongside tourism.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the average rental income for multi-family properties in Bodega Bay? +
Vacation rental units average $200-350 nightly during peak season, generating $60K-100K+ annually per unit. Long-term rentals yield $1,500-2,200 monthly. Properties with mixed models optimize returns. Performance varies based on location, amenities, and management quality. Professional operators typically report 70-85% annual occupancy.
Are there zoning restrictions for multi-family rentals in Bodega Bay? +
Yes, Bodega Bay has specific coastal zone regulations requiring coastal permits for conversions or new construction. Vacation rental licensing requires compliance with Sonoma County ordinances. Some neighborhoods restrict short-term rentals. Verify zoning designations and obtain professional legal review before purchasing for rental conversion purposes.
What's the typical price appreciation for multi-family homes here? +
Bodega Bay multi-family properties appreciate 3-5% annually on average, influenced by coastal demand and limited inventory. Strong rental income supports value growth. Properties with dual-income models appreciate faster than traditional rentals. Long-term trends favor appreciation, particularly for well-maintained, fully-licensed vacation rental properties.
Is property management challenging in Bodega Bay? +
Professional property management is essential, especially for vacation rentals requiring daily guest coordination. Several experienced local companies specialize in Bodega Bay properties. Costs typically run 25-35% of vacation rental revenue, 8-12% for long-term rentals. Strong management maximizes occupancy, maintains quality, and ensures regulatory compliance effectively.
What financing options exist for multi-family investment properties? +
Conventional loans, investment portfolios, and commercial mortgages apply to multi-family purchases. Vacation rental properties may require specialized lenders. Down payments typically 20-25% for investment properties. Portfolio lenders consider rental income for qualification. Interest rates average 6-7.5% currently.
